Explaining technical terms in a clear and accessible way is essential for effective communication, especially in today’s technology-driven world. This skill helps ensure that everyone, regardless of their background, can understand complex concepts.

Understanding the Concept
When we explain a technical term, we aim to break down the complexities into simpler ideas. This involves using everyday language, relatable examples, and avoiding jargon that might confuse the listener.

Examples of Effective Explanations
For instance, if you were to explain ‘cloud computing’, you might say: “Cloud computing allows you to store and access your data over the internet instead of on your personal computer.” This explanation highlights the core idea without overwhelming the listener with technical details.

Another example could be explaining ‘artificial intelligence’: “Artificial intelligence refers to machines that can perform tasks that usually require human intelligence, like recognizing speech or playing chess.”

Common Mistakes
One common mistake when explaining technical terms is using too much jargon. For example, saying “cloud infrastructure” instead of simply explaining what the cloud does can alienate the listener. Always aim for clarity.

Tips for Effective Explanations

  • Use analogies: Relate complex ideas to familiar concepts. For example, compare the internet to a library where you can access information from anywhere.
  • Encourage questions: Invite the listener to ask questions if they do not understand something.
  • Be patient: Take your time to ensure the listener grasps the concept.

How to Practice
To practice explaining technical terms, try the following:
1. Choose a technical term you know well.
2. Write down a simple explanation as if you were explaining it to a friend.
3. Test your explanation on someone unfamiliar with the topic and ask for feedback.

Preguntas frecuentes

What is the importance of explaining technical terms clearly?

Explaining technical terms clearly helps ensure that everyone can understand complex concepts, which is essential for effective communication.

How can I simplify complex technical terms?

You can simplify complex terms by using everyday language, relatable examples, and avoiding jargon.

What are some common mistakes when explaining technical terms?

Common mistakes include using too much jargon, assuming prior knowledge, and not encouraging questions.

What role do analogies play in explaining technical concepts?

Analogies help relate complex ideas to familiar concepts, making them easier to understand.

How can I practice my explaining skills?

You can practice by choosing a technical term, writing a simple explanation, and testing it on someone unfamiliar with the topic.

What is a good strategy for encouraging questions during an explanation?

A good strategy is to invite the listener to ask questions and reassure them that it’s okay to seek clarification.

How can I ensure my explanations are engaging?

You can make your explanations engaging by being enthusiastic, using visuals, and relating the topic to the listener’s interests.
